ApplicationHealthPolicy interface
Bir uygulamanın veya alt varlıklarından birinin sistem durumunu değerlendirmek için kullanılan bir sistem durumu ilkesini tanımlar.
Özellikler
| consider |
Uyarıların hatalarla aynı önem derecesine sahip olup olmadığını gösterir. Varsayılan değer: false. |
| default |
Bir hizmet türünün sistem durumunu değerlendirmek için varsayılan olarak kullanılan sistem durumu ilkesi. |
| max |
İyi durumda olmayan dağıtılan uygulamaların izin verilen en yüksek yüzdesi. İzin verilen değerler sıfırdan 100'e kadar bayt değerleridir. Yüzde, dağıtılan uygulamaların hata olarak kabul edilmeden önce iyi durumda olmayan en yüksek tolere edilen yüzdesini temsil eder. Bu, iyi durumda olmayan dağıtılan uygulamaların sayısı, uygulamanın o anda kümede dağıtıldığı düğüm sayısına bölünerek hesaplanır. Hesaplama, az sayıda düğümde bir hatayı tolere etmek için yukarı yuvarlar. Varsayılan yüzde sıfırdır. Varsayılan değer: 0. |
| service |
Hizmet türü adı başına hizmet türü sistem durumu ilkesine sahip eşleme. Harita varsayılan olarak boş olur. |
Özellik Ayrıntıları
considerWarningAsError
Uyarıların hatalarla aynı önem derecesine sahip olup olmadığını gösterir. Varsayılan değer: false.
considerWarningAsError?: boolean
Özellik Değeri
boolean
defaultServiceTypeHealthPolicy
Bir hizmet türünün sistem durumunu değerlendirmek için varsayılan olarak kullanılan sistem durumu ilkesi.
defaultServiceTypeHealthPolicy?: ServiceTypeHealthPolicy
Özellik Değeri
maxPercentUnhealthyDeployedApplications
İyi durumda olmayan dağıtılan uygulamaların izin verilen en yüksek yüzdesi. İzin verilen değerler sıfırdan 100'e kadar bayt değerleridir. Yüzde, dağıtılan uygulamaların hata olarak kabul edilmeden önce iyi durumda olmayan en yüksek tolere edilen yüzdesini temsil eder. Bu, iyi durumda olmayan dağıtılan uygulamaların sayısı, uygulamanın o anda kümede dağıtıldığı düğüm sayısına bölünerek hesaplanır. Hesaplama, az sayıda düğümde bir hatayı tolere etmek için yukarı yuvarlar. Varsayılan yüzde sıfırdır. Varsayılan değer: 0.
maxPercentUnhealthyDeployedApplications?: number
Özellik Değeri
number
serviceTypeHealthPolicyMap
Hizmet türü adı başına hizmet türü sistem durumu ilkesine sahip eşleme. Harita varsayılan olarak boş olur.
serviceTypeHealthPolicyMap?: ServiceTypeHealthPolicyMapItem[]